Mana Burn

Heart’s desire

A gun for hire

Taken care of

Oh so gently

Oh so kindly

Compassion’s sweet embrace

A mercy

To you

Must be done

Suffering must abate

Won’t be long

Winter’s over

Spring is here

Thy will be done

Down a pill, just for fun

Far away from the pier

A single little lit lantern

Lightning strikes a lonely light

Focus from the fire

So too does your soul burn
